Finasteride is a 5-alpha-reductase inhibitor. Basically, it works by preventing the conversion of Testosterone into its more potent form, Dihydrotestosterone. Without DHT a lot of the effects of Testosterone, including maintaining your libido, are significantly reduced. I was on it for about a year to speed up my hair recovery and it definitely worked wonders, but that was along with replacing my testosterone with estrogen, so the "side effects" were actually the intended effects in my case.
